Professional Competences and Employment for the Future Journalist: the Case of graduate students in Journalism at Universidad Cardenal Herrera-CEU
Abstract
We present a research study focused into two different aspects; the achievement of professional competences in graduate students in Journalism at Universidad Cardenal Herrera (UCH), together with the importance that they concede to several aspects related to an employment. We extract data from the Reflex Report of ANECA entitled, The flexible professional in the Information Society establishing its comparison with our own sources obtained from the graduate students in Journalism at UCH. We also reflect empirical evidence of different levels of professional competence performance from last academic year graduate students in Journalism from the old program (named Licenciatura).
